Quit Safari.
Open the Library folder in your home folder as follows:
☞ If running Mac OS X 10.7 or later, hold down the option key and select Go ▹ Library from the Finder menu bar.
☞ If running an older version of Mac OS X, select Go ▹ Go to Folder… from the Finder menu bar and enter “~/Library” (without the quotes) in the text box that opens.
Delete the following items from the Library folder:
Caches/com.apple.Safari/Cache.db
Preferences/com.apple.quicktime.plugin.preferences.plist
Preferences/QuickTime Preferences
Relaunch Safari and test.

    Hmmm. It sounds like a possible problem with the system prior to updating. If you've done this already don't be upset by the suggestion. I'm just trying to cover the bases.
    Repairing the Hard Drive and Permissions
    Boot from your OS X Installer disc. After the installer loads select your language and click on the Continue button. Then select Disk Utility from the Installer menu (Utilities menu for Tiger.) After DU loads select your OS X volume from the list on the left, click on the First Aid tab, then click on the Repair Disk button. If DU reports any errors that have been fixed, then re-run Repair Disk until no errors are reported. If no errors are reported click on the Repair Permissions button. Wait until the operation completes, then quit DU and return to the installer. Now shutdown the computer for a couple of minutes and then restart normally.
    If DU reports errors it cannot fix, then you will need Disk Warrior (3.0.3 for Tiger) and/or TechTool Pro (4.5.1 for Tiger) to repair the drive. If you don't have either of them or if neither of them can fix the drive, then you will need to reformat the drive and reinstall OS X. Note that Disk Warrior will not work on Intel Macs.
    Download the standalone 10.4.8 Combo Updater (be sure to get the correct version - Intel or PPC - for your Macs. Reinstall the update using the Combo Updater.
    As an added precaution I would recommend you first boot into safe mode before doing the above.
    There is a shareware utility called Printer Setup Repair (www.macupdate.com) that you can also try. It is sometimes very useful for fixing problems with the printing system.

    Bad timing.  Reapply the security update:
    http://support.apple.com/kb/DL1489
    What happened is that version 1.0 of the security update was available for a bit of time this weekend, and that disabled Rosetta.  Version 1.1 brought it back.
